First Infraction Penalties



When facing your initial DWI cost, what penalties should you expect? You might deal with a series of repercussions, starting with fines that can reach up to $2,000.

Along with financial penalties, you could additionally handle a permit suspension, normally lasting from 90 days to a year, depending on your state's regulations.

Social work is one more likely need; you might require to complete an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.

If you're convicted, you may also have to go to a DWI education and learning program, which can include a significant time commitment.

In many cases, you might also be called for to install an ignition interlock gadget in your automobile, which stops you from driving if you've been consuming.

Repeat Violation Fines



Facing a repeat DWI cost can lead to dramatically harsher fines than an initial infraction. If you're caught driving while intoxicated once again, you might encounter boosted fines, longer permit suspensions, and even mandatory jail time. The lawful system tends to watch repeat offenders as a greater threat to public safety, so your repercussions will certainly show that.

For your 2nd dui, charges typically double. You could be checking out fines varying from $1,000 to $5,000, depending on your state. Long-term Effects



Long-lasting consequences of a drunk driving charge can affect numerous aspects of your life for years to come.

As soon as you've been founded guilty, you might deal with higher insurance costs and even difficulty getting vehicle insurance in any way. Insurance provider commonly see you as a higher threat, which can result in considerable economic pressure.

Your job opportunity may also decrease. Lots of employers conduct background checks, and a DWI sentence can raise red flags, possibly costing you work offers or promos. Particular occupations, particularly those requiring a tidy driving record, might be entirely off-limits.

In addition, you might handle social stigma. Buddies and family members might see you in different ways, which can result in stretched partnerships. You might also find it tough to participate in neighborhood tasks because of the shame or judgment you feel.

Lastly, the psychological toll can't be ignored. Anxiousness, guilt, and tension can linger long after the lawful penalties have been served, affecting your mental health and total wellness.
